I see way too much imbalance these days in social media and new age groups. Everyone thinks that you should get rid of negative people and things in your life. Every time I see or read that, I cringe. My hair stands on end and I shutter at the thoughts these people are passing on to others.
We can't always have rainbows every day because a rainbow means the storm clouds have just passed. In order to see the rainbows, we need to feel the storms and the rain. It takes the rough parts to see the beautiful parts. Unfortunately what too many are claiming as "truth" is that they can have the rainbows without the storms.
If you get rid of the negative stuff, you're really just numbing yourself out in life. It is that plain and simple. Without the negative and rough and bad stuff, you're only living half a life. Part of life is pain and the other part is learning from the pain. Okay, I realize I just simplified things too much, but that's the jest of the issue I'm raising.
